Coverage Options for Libertyville Property Owners

Dwelling Fire Forms

  • DP-1 (Basic): Named perils; ACV (Actual Cash Value) on many losses. Best for lower-value properties.
  • DP-2 (Broad): Adds perils like falling objects and accidental discharge of water; a solid baseline option.
  • DP-3 (Special): Open perils on the dwelling with exclusions; ideal for well-maintained properties.

Essential Add-Ons

  • Premises Liability: Cover potential claims; many choose $1M for added protection.
  • Loss of Use: Replace income during repairs; align to local market rents.
  • Ordinance or Law: Covers code upgrades for older structures.
  • Water Backup & Service Line: Address common risks in pre-1960s homes.
  • Equipment Breakdown: For sudden failures in systems like HVAC.
  • Vandalism/Malicious Mischief: Important if properties are vacant.
  • Flood: NFIP or private options for flood-prone areas.

DP-1 vs DP-2 vs DP-3 (Quick Compare)

FeatureDP-1DP-2DP-3
Peril scopeBasic named perilsBroad named perilsSpecial (open perils) on dwelling
SettlementOften ACVACV or RC (varies)Typically RC (with conditions)
Water (accidental discharge)Usually excludedIncludedIncluded (subject to exclusions)
Best fitLower cost, limited needsBalanced protectionWell-maintained properties
